Who funds Foundation for Resilient Societies

EIN 46-2404814 · Nashua, NH · NTEE R99

Foundation for Resilient Societies of Nashua, NH (EIN 46-2404814) was named as a grant recipient by 3 funders in 3 grants paid totaling $287,521 in tax years 2020–2022, as reported on the funders' Forms 990-PF and 990 Schedule I.
